文章目录IPython vs python shellpycharm vs python IDLE 首先,最容易区别的就是python,这个是编程语言,相当于是一个解释器,是后端。其他四个都是前端,都要依赖它。 IPython vs python shell这两个都是交互式,交互式的好处就是:写一句(或一段)代码回车(或者执行)就会执行一句(或一段)代码,而且变量不会丢失,下一句代码可以使用。
转载
2023-06-29 15:34:18
190阅读
IDE(集成开发环境)是一种软件应用程序,为程序员提供了进行软件开发的便利。好比Microsoft Word对作家的意义。好比Adobe Photoshop对创作者的意义。这是我们工作的工具。 编程的旅程始于多年使用IDLE,先是Sublime Text Editor,然后是PyCharm,然后是Notebooks。下面列出了许多其他IDE,值得探讨。在下面的文章中,将介绍一下IDE,并根据自己的
转载
2023-09-21 11:09:48
245阅读
Python 的编码工具很多。目前最流行的是 pycharm,关于 pycharm 的安装使用请参考 PyCharm安装使用教程。而学习过程中,我觉得最好用的,还是 Python 自带的练习工具 IDLE。这款工具不用安装,装好 Python 后就有了。这款工具最大的好处,就是变量的值、函数返回值都可以直接展示,不用打印即可查看。这极大了方便学习过程中,需要不断的查看各种语句的执行结果。基本使用打
转载
2023-07-20 22:35:13
124阅读
IPython介绍ipython 是一个 python 的交互式 shell ,比默认的 python shell 好用得多,支持变量自动补全,自动缩进,支持 bash shell命令,内置了许多很有用的功能和函数。学ipython 将会让我们以一种更高的效率来使用 python 。同时它也是利用Python进行科学计算和交互可视化的一个最佳的平台。
IPython提供了两个主要的组件:1.一个强
转载
2023-06-14 15:19:46
120阅读
好吧,一直准备学点啥,前些日子也下好了一些python电子书,但之后又没影了。年龄大了,就是不爱学习了。那就现在开始吧。安装python 3Mac OS X会预装python 2,Linux的大多数版本也是如此(也可能预装python 3)。但Windows有所不同,它未内置任何python版本。检查你的计算机上是否安装python3:Mac OS X或Linux:python -V&
转载
2023-08-16 16:05:43
157阅读
# 如何安装和使用 IPython 和 IPython3
IPython 是一个强大的交互式 Python shell,提供更丰富的功能和用户体验。为了确保你可以顺利完成 IPython 的安装与使用,这里将详细介绍整个流程和需要执行的步骤。
## 流程概述
下面是一个简洁的流程表,显示了实现 IPython 和 IPython3 所需的步骤。
| 步骤 | 描述
Spyder简介Spyder (前身是 Pydee) 是一个强大的交互式 Python 语言开发环境,提供高级的代码编辑、交互测试、调试等特性,支持包括 Windows、Linux 和 OS X 系统。● 菜单栏(Menu bar):显示可用于操纵Spyder各项功能的不同选项。● 工具栏(Tools bar):通过单击图标可快速执行Spyder中最常用的操作,将鼠标
转载
2023-09-06 16:52:46
107阅读
1. Jupyter狭义的 Jupyter 仅指是Jupyter Notebook,广义上来讲则指整个 Jupyter project(或者Project Jupyter)Project Jupyter 下包括 Jupyter Notebook,Jupyter kernels,JupyterHub,JupyterLab,Jupyter{Book}等Jupyter Notebook以前又称为IPyt
转载
2023-07-09 10:50:15
345阅读
第一次用Jupyter Notebook是在大四的时候上了coursea上吴恩达新开的一系列的deep learning的课,不得不说,实在是太惊艳了。 支持HTML 支持LaTeX 支持插入PDF 支持插入Youtube视频 ... (附一张deeplearning.ai课程作业的截图) 大概就是传说中的“可以写出花了”。 不过我是隔了很久才意识到IPython和Ju
转载
2023-07-04 21:13:57
91阅读
IPython的开发者吸收了标准解释器的基本概念,在此基础上进行了大量的改进,创造出一个令人惊奇的工具。在它的主页上是这么说的:“这是一个增强的交互式Pythonshell。”具有tab补全,对象自省,强大的历史机制,内嵌的源代码编辑,集成Python调试器,%run机制,宏,创建多个环境以及调用系统shell的能力。1)IPython与标准Python的最大区别在于,Ipython会对命令提示符
转载
2024-02-07 14:23:49
201阅读
我有一个可在ipython内运行的脚本,但是当我尝试从命令行运行相同的脚本时,我收到要导入的本地模块的导入错误:from helper_functions.email_from_server import send_email错误:ImportError:没有名为helper_functions.email_from_server的模块该脚本从Ipython导入,没有任何问题。相对而言,我在ipy
转载
2024-02-04 10:58:28
73阅读
Python是一种计算机程序设计语言。是一种面向对象的动态类型语言,最初被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越来越多被用于独立的、大型项目的开发。PyCharm 是 Python 的专用 IDE,地位类似于 Java 的 IDE Eclipse。功能齐全的集成开发环境同时提供收费版和免费版,即专业版和社区版。PyCharm 是安装最快的 IDE,且安装后的
转载
2023-08-06 13:42:55
535阅读
**bpython 和 ipython: 一个交互式编程的比较**
在Python编程中,交互式环境是一种非常有用的工具。它允许用户逐行执行代码并立即看到结果,这对于调试和测试代码非常有帮助。Python有许多交互式环境可供选择,其中两个最受欢迎的是bpython和ipython。本文将介绍这两个工具的特点并进行比较。
**bpython**
bpython是一个简单而强大的交互式Pytho
原创
2023-11-03 05:33:36
151阅读
Jupyter内核就是IPython(Interactive Python);你看到的按tab键能够自动提示/补齐都是IPython实现的。 IPython其实不只限于IPython,其实你看到的IDE里面的tab键自动感应都是IPython的实现,比如Pycharm里面的Anaconda库就是包含
转载
2018-06-04 09:24:00
152阅读
2评论
# 如何使用 Python 和 IPython:新手入门指南
作为一名刚入行的开发者,学习使用 Python 和 IPython 是一个很好的起点。这篇文章将详细介绍如何开始使用这两个工具。我们将厘清流程,通过步骤说明和具体代码示例,确保你能顺利入门。
## 流程概览
在学习如何使用 Python 和 IPython 的过程中,总体流程可以分为以下几个步骤:
| 步骤 | 描述 |
|--
python里面调试确实有点烦恼,尤其是在vim里,想要尝试一些简单的编码问题,实在是有点麻烦,不想到命令行模式一行一行执行,也不想再新建一个文件测试一个简单的功能。而且就是不管这些,测试一个简单的功能如学习语法、测试编码、测试新学习的包等,在IDE里面测试,看不到每个部分的output效果(除非自己手动去命令行里复制或截屏),在命令行里测试,则没法轻松撤销前面的代码。。。。所以这时候才想到好像前
# 教你使用IPython和IDLE
## 1. 概述
在本文中,我将教你如何使用IPython和IDLE这两个开发工具。IPython是一个交互式的Python解释器,它为开发者提供了更好的交互体验和功能扩展。IDLE是Python自带的集成开发环境,它提供了编辑器、解释器和调试器等功能。
下面是整个流程的步骤表格: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 安
原创
2023-10-14 09:03:30
43阅读
IPython是一个python shell的扩展,强调了IPython可交互性和探索性计
转载
2022-10-19 15:03:56
293阅读
放个对比吧,个人更喜欢用PyCharm。PyCharm平台:Linux/macOS/Windows类型:Python 专用 IDEPyCharm 是 Python 的专用 IDE,地位类似于 Java 的 IDE Eclipse。功能齐全的集成开发环境同时提供收费版和免费版,即专业版和社区版。PyCharm 是安装最快的 IDE,且安装后的配置也非常简单,因此 PyCharm 基本上是数据科学家和
转载
2023-09-17 11:32:59
68阅读
Python和pycharm是不一样的,二者有本质的区别。Python是一种计算机程序设计语言。是一种面向对象的动态类型语言,最初被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越来越多被用于独立的、大型项目的开发。PyCharm 是 Python 的专用 IDE,地位类似于 Java 的 IDE Eclipse。功能齐全的集成开发环境同时提供收费版和免费版,即专业版
转载
2023-07-02 12:35:32
68阅读